Ingredients
For the Stir-Fry:
- Chicken breast – 1 pound, thinly sliced
- Onion – 1, sliced
- Bell peppers – 1 red and 1 green, sliced
- Celery – 2 stalks, chopped
- Bok choy – 1 cup, roughly chopped
- Green onions – 2, chopped
- Garlic – 3 cloves, minced
- Ginger – 1 teaspoon, minced
- Vegetable oil – 2 tablespoons
For the Sauce:
- Soy sauce – 1/4 cup
- Oyster sauce – 2 tablespoons
- Sesame oil – 1 teaspoon
- Cornstarch – 1 teaspoon, dissolved in 2 tablespoons of water
- Brown sugar – 1 tablespoon
- Chicken broth – 1/4 cup
Instructions
- Prepare the Sauce
In a small bowl, whisk together soy sauce, oyster sauce, sesame oil, dissolved cornstarch, brown sugar, and chicken broth. Stir until the sugar is dissolved and the mixture is smooth. Set aside. - Cook the Chicken
Heat 1 tablespoon of vegetable oil in a large wok or skillet over medium-high heat. Once hot, add the thinly sliced chicken and stir-fry for 4–5 minutes or until fully cooked and lightly browned. Remove the chicken from the pan and set it aside. - Stir-Fry the Vegetables
In the same pan, add the remaining tablespoon of vegetable oil. Toss in the garlic and ginger, cooking for 30 seconds until fragrant. Add the onion, bell peppers, and celery, stir-frying for 3–4 minutes until the vegetables start to soften but still have a crunch. - Add Bok Choy and Green Onions
Add the bok choy and green onions to the pan, stir-frying for another 2 minutes until the bok choy begins to wilt. - Combine Chicken and Sauce
Return the cooked chicken to the pan. Pour the prepared sauce over the chicken and vegetables, stirring everything together. Cook for 2–3 minutes, allowing the sauce to thicken and coat the ingredients evenly. - Serve and Enjoy
Remove the stir-fry from heat and serve immediately. This dish pairs perfectly with steamed rice or noodles.
